Step 1: Start With a Moving Timeline
Begin organizing your long distance relocation at least 8–12 weeks in advance. A detailed timeline ensures you don’t leave critical tasks to the last minute.
- 12 Weeks Before: Research moving companies and request estimates.
- 10 Weeks Before: Create an inventory of your belongings.

- 6 Weeks Before: Begin downsizing and selling or donating unwanted items.
- 4 Weeks Before: Order moving supplies, confirm travel arrangements, and schedule utility transfers.
- 2 Weeks Before: Start packing non-essential items.
- 1 Week Before: Finalize packing and confirm details with your movers.

Step 2: Create a Comprehensive Inventory List
Long distance moves require knowing exactly what is being transported. An inventory list helps:
- Track your belongings during loading, transport, and delivery.
- Identify items that need special handling, such as antiques or pianos.
- Provide accurate insurance documentation in case of loss or damage.

Step 3: Packing Strategies for Long Distance Moving
Packing is one of the most time-consuming aspects of relocation. Done improperly, it can result in broken items or unnecessary delays. Following proven strategies saves time and reduces risk.
Label Everything Clearly
- Use color-coded labels for each room.
- Mark fragile boxes prominently.
- Number your boxes and cross-reference them with your inventory list.
Protect Fragile and Valuable Items
- Wrap glassware and electronics in bubble wrap and packing paper.
- Use sturdy, double-walled boxes for heavy items.

Pack Essentials Separately
- Important documents, chargers, medications, and a change of clothes should stay with you during travel.
- Keep valuables like jewelry or passports out of the moving truck.

Step 5: Coordinate Travel and Logistics
While your movers transport your belongings, you’ll need to plan your own travel. Whether you’re flying or driving, confirm all reservations in advance. If traveling with pets, review local and provincial requirements for safe and legal transportation.
Step 6: Stay on Top of Communication
Clear communication with your moving company prevents last-minute confusion. Confirm the following before moving day:
- Pick-up and delivery dates.
- Insurance coverage.
- Contact information for the driver and moving coordinator.

Step 7: Prepare for Moving Day
On moving day, stay organized with a personal checklist:
- Set aside snacks, water, and essentials for the day.
- Supervise the loading process.
- Double-check your home to ensure nothing is left behind.
Ottawa residents moving out of apartments or condos should also schedule elevator access in advance to avoid delays.
